Is the quotient of two irrational numbers always an irrational number? 
<pre>
No
</pre>
why not?
<pre>
Because {{{2pi}}} is irrational and {{{3pi}}} is irrational;
however when you form their quotient {{{2pi/(3pi)}}} the {{{pi}}}'s
cancel {{{(2cross(pi))/(3cross(pi))}}} you get {{{2/3}}} so it is
rational.
</pre>
Show worked out examples to support your reply.
<pre>
{{{(2sqrt(3))/(3sqrt(3))=2cross(sqrt(3))/3cross(sqrt(3))=2/3}}}

{{{(7sqrt(5))/(8sqrt(5))=7cross(sqrt(5))/8cross(sqrt(5))=7/8}}}

You can make up bunches like this.
